Mengapa Windows 7 dapat digunakan sebagai web server ?, windows 7 dapat digunakan sebagai web server karena sistem operasi ini memiliki fitur Internet Information Services (IIS), sebuah perangkat lunak server web yang dapat diaktifkan pada Windows 7. IIS memungkinkan pengguna untuk meng-host website, blog, atau aplikasi web secara lokal pada komputer mereka.
Artikel ini akan membahas langkah-langkah lengkap dalam membuat web server di Windows 7 dengan menggunakan IIS. Langkah-langkah tersebut diantaranya meliputi. Persyaratan sistem,
Persyaratan Sistem
Sebelum memulai membuat web server di Windows 7, pastikan bahwa komputer yang digunakan memenuhi persyaratan sistem yang dibutuhkan. Persyaratan hardware dan software yang dibutuhkan untuk membuat web server di Windows 7 adalah sebagai berikut:Hardware yang diperlukan:
- Processor 1GHz atau lebih cepat
- RAM minimal 1GB
- Ruang hard disk kosong minimal 16GB
Software yang diperlukan:
- Windows 7 Professional, Enterprise, atau Ultimate (edisi Home Basic dan Starter tidak memiliki fitur IIS)
- Fitur IIS sudah diaktifkan pada Windows 7
- Web browser seperti Google Chrome, Mozilla Firefox, atau Microsoft Edge
Proses Instalasi
Ada dua cara yang dapat dilakukan untuk membuat web server di Windows 7, yaitu dengan menggunakan fitur IIS bawaan Windows 7 atau dengan menggunakan perangkat lunak pihak ketiga seperti XAMPP. Berikut adalah langkah-langkah instalasi untuk kedua opsi tersebut:Cara install Windows 7 untuk web server:
- Beli atau unduh file ISO Windows 7 dari situs resmi Microsoft.
- Burn file ISO ke dalam DVD atau buat bootable USB menggunakan software seperti Rufus.
- Masukkan DVD atau USB bootable ke komputer dan restart komputer.
- Boot komputer dari DVD atau USB bootable.
- Ikuti instruksi pada layar untuk memilih bahasa, zona waktu, dan jenis instalasi.
- Setelah selesai, pastikan fitur IIS sudah diaktifkan pada Windows 7. Cara mengaktifkan IIS dapat dilihat pada bagian selanjutnya.
Cara install XAMPP di Windows 7:
- Unduh installer XAMPP dari situs resmi Apache Friends (https://www.apachefriends.org/download.html).
- Jalankan installer dan pilih komponen yang ingin diinstal. Secara default, Apache, MySQL, dan PHP sudah dipilih.
- Tentukan lokasi instalasi dan ikuti instruksi pada layar.
- Setelah selesai, XAMPP sudah siap digunakan sebagai web server.
Konfigurasi Web Server
Konfigurasi web server di Windows 7:
Setelah fitur IIS diaktifkan pada Windows 7, langkah selanjutnya adalah melakukan konfigurasi web server. Berikut adalah langkah-langkah konfigurasi web server di Windows 7:- Buka Control Panel dan cari "Administrative Tools".
- Klik "Internet Information Services (IIS) Manager".
- Di sisi kiri jendela, pilih "Sites" dan klik "Add Website".
- Isi "Site name" dengan nama website yang ingin dibuat.
- Tentukan "Physical path" yang merupakan lokasi folder website pada komputer.
- Pada "Binding", tentukan protokol (HTTP atau HTTPS) dan port yang akan digunakan oleh website.
- Klik "OK" untuk menyimpan konfigurasi website.
Cara mengaktifkan IIS di Windows 7:
Jika fitur IIS belum diaktifkan pada Windows 7, berikut adalah langkah-langkah untuk mengaktifkannya:- Buka Control Panel dan cari "Programs and Features".
- Klik "Turn Windows features on or off".
- Pada jendela "Windows Features", cari "Internet Information Services" dan klik tanda "+" untuk melihat komponen yang terkait.
- Pastikan "Web Management Tools" dan "World Wide Web Services" sudah dipilih.
- Buka "World Wide Web Services" dan pilih "Application Development Features".
- Pastikan "ASP.NET" sudah dipilih jika akan menggunakan aplikasi web berbasis .NET.
- Klik "OK" untuk menyimpan konfigurasi.
Keamanan
Cara mengamankan web server di Windows 7:
Keamanan web server di Windows 7 sangat penting untuk melindungi data dan informasi yang ada di dalamnya dari ancaman yang tidak diinginkan. Berikut adalah beberapa cara untuk mengamankan web server di Windows 7:- Selalu menginstal update keamanan dan perbaikan bug pada sistem operasi dan aplikasi web server.
- Gunakan password yang kuat dan kompleks untuk akses ke web server.
- Batasi akses ke file dan folder pada web server dengan memberikan hak akses yang tepat kepada pengguna.
- Aktifkan firewall pada Windows 7 dan buat aturan untuk membatasi akses ke web server.
- Gunakan HTTPS dan SSL/TLS untuk enkripsi data dan informasi yang dikirim dan diterima oleh web server. Cara mengaktifkan SSL/TLS pada Windows 7 akan dijelaskan pada bagian berikutnya.
Jenis-jenis SSL untuk web server di Windows 7:
SSL/TLS adalah protokol yang digunakan untuk mengenkripsi data dan informasi yang dikirim dan diterima oleh web server. Terdapat beberapa jenis SSL/TLS yang dapat digunakan pada web server di Windows 7, yaitu:- Domain Validated SSL: Jenis SSL ini memeriksa keabsahan domain website. Proses validasi dilakukan dengan mengirim email ke alamat email yang terdaftar di DNS. SSL ini cocok untuk website yang tidak mengandung data sensitif dan tidak memerlukan verifikasi identitas yang ketat.
- Organization Validated SSL: Jenis SSL ini memeriksa keabsahan domain dan organisasi yang mengelola website. Proses validasi melibatkan verifikasi dokumen yang menunjukkan keberadaan organisasi. SSL ini cocok untuk website yang mengandung data sensitif dan memerlukan verifikasi identitas yang lebih ketat.
- Extended Validated SSL: Jenis SSL ini memeriksa keabsahan domain, organisasi, dan informasi kontak yang terkait dengan website. Proses validasi melibatkan verifikasi yang lebih ketat dan lebih lama. SSL ini cocok untuk website yang mengandung data sensitif dan memerlukan verifikasi identitas yang sangat ketat.
- Memilih jenis SSL yang tepat tergantung pada kebutuhan dan jenis website yang akan dioperasikan. Pastikan untuk menginstal SSL/TLS pada web server dan mengaktifkannya untuk melindungi data dan informasi yang ada di dalamnya.
Pemecahan Masalah
Masalah umum pada web server di Windows 7:
Web server di Windows 7 dapat mengalami beberapa masalah umum yang dapat menyebabkan website tidak dapat diakses atau tidak berjalan dengan baik. Beberapa masalah umum tersebut antara lain:- Port yang diblokir oleh firewall: Port tertentu pada web server mungkin diblokir oleh firewall yang dapat menyebabkan website tidak dapat diakses. Pastikan untuk memeriksa dan membuat aturan pada firewall untuk memungkinkan akses ke port yang dibutuhkan oleh web server.
- Konfigurasi web server yang salah: Kesalahan pada konfigurasi web server seperti kesalahan pengaturan DNS atau file konfigurasi dapat menyebabkan website tidak dapat diakses atau tidak berjalan dengan baik.
- Masalah dengan aplikasi web: Masalah pada aplikasi web seperti kesalahan kode atau kesalahan konfigurasi dapat menyebabkan website tidak berjalan dengan baik atau bahkan mengalami crash.
Cara memperbaiki web server yang error di Windows 7:
- Berikut adalah beberapa langkah yang dapat diambil untuk memperbaiki web server yang error di Windows 7:
- Pastikan firewall telah dikonfigurasi dengan benar dan tidak memblokir port yang dibutuhkan oleh web server.
- Periksa dan pastikan konfigurasi web server telah diatur dengan benar, termasuk pengaturan DNS dan file konfigurasi.
- Lakukan uji coba pada aplikasi web untuk mencari dan memperbaiki kesalahan kode atau konfigurasi yang mungkin terjadi.
- Pastikan sistem operasi Windows 7 telah diperbarui dengan update terbaru dan aplikasi web telah diupdate ke versi terbaru.
- Periksa log web server untuk menemukan pesan kesalahan dan mencari tahu penyebab masalah yang terjadi.
- Jika masalah masih terjadi, mungkin perlu meminta bantuan dari teknisi atau ahli web server untuk membantu memperbaiki masalah yang terjadi.
Kesimpulan, artikel ini memberikan panduan lengkap tentang cara membuat web server di Windows 7. Artikel ini mencakup persyaratan sistem yang diperlukan untuk membuat web server, proses instalasi XAMPP, konfigurasi web server, keamanan web server, dan pemecahan masalah umum yang terkait dengan web server di Windows 7.
Membuat web server di Windows 7 dapat menjadi pilihan yang tepat bagi individu atau organisasi yang ingin memiliki kontrol penuh atas server mereka tanpa harus mengeluarkan biaya tambahan untuk sistem operasi yang lebih mahal. Dengan mengikuti panduan ini, pembaca dapat membuat dan mengkonfigurasi web server mereka sendiri dengan mudah dan aman.
Artikel ini mengajak pembaca untuk mencoba membuat web server di Windows 7 untuk mengembangkan keterampilan mereka dan memperluas pengetahuan mereka tentang web development. Dengan mengikuti panduan ini, pembaca dapat memperoleh pengalaman praktis dalam membuat dan mengelola web server di Windows 7.